Google's productivity suite (Gmail, Drive, Docs, Meet, Calendar), positioned as the alternative to Microsoft 365 for organizations that grew up on Gmail rather than Outlook. Distinctive for its collaborative document model (real-time Google Docs preceded and inspired Office online) and its aggressive Gemini AI integration bundled into paid tiers in 2024-2026. Priced $6-$18/user/mo across four Business tiers. Losing enterprise share to M365 (Copilot bundling); still dominant in startups and education.

Daily planning tool positioned as the alternative to Todoist and TickTick for knowledge workers who want a calm, opinionated way to plan the day. Distinctive for its "one task at a time" focus mode and its integration with existing calendars (Google, Outlook) rather than replacing them. Priced $20/user/mo (only monthly and annual options, no free tier). Popular with founders, executives, and creators who resonate with the "work with intention" mindset.

Google Workspace

Google Workspace is worth it if… Google Workspace is worth it as the default productivity suite for teams (1-1000+ people) that want Gmail + Drive + Meet + Docs + Calendar in one bundle — particularly if you want mobile-first collaboration and don't need deep Microsoft Office file compatibility. Business Starter covers small teams; Business Standard adds Meet recording and larger storage; Business Plus adds vault and advanced admin.
